    Grand Theatre de Quebec

    Inaugurated in 1971, the Grand Thée offers two concert halls: the 1,878-seat Louis-Fréchette hall and the 519-seat Octave-Crémazie hall. Dancing, theatre, music, operas and variety shows are featured. The main entrance is graced with an impressive mural by artist Jordi Bonet. Guided tours for groups every day from 9 a.m. to 4 p.m., upon reservation.

    Salle Dina-Bélanger

    The salle Dina-Bélanger presents and produces shows focusing mainly on the sphere of music for youth. Along with its regular programming, the 502-seat concert hall is also used for corporative, cultural and social events.

    Espace Bon-Pasteur

    Located in the historic Bon-Pasteur chapel, Espace Bon-Pasteur displays numerous works by Plamondon, Levasseur, Favre, Casavant and the Soeurs du Bon-Pasteur de Québec. Open to the public 365 days a year, the Chapel is available for guided tours, concerts, conferences, recording sessions, rehearsals and other religious and cultural activities.

    Theatre La Dame Blanche au Parc de la Chute Montmorency

    Located ten minutes from downtown Québec City in the Montmorency Falls Park, this 461-seat theatre is home to the Productions Jean-Bernard Hébert theatre company. Plays are presented from June to August each year.
